Well, the skiing season officially got underway in the Austrian Alps last weekend, but sadly, the snow has yet to arrive in many ski resorts! The temperatures have dropped considerably over the past two weeks, but with no snow forecast between now and Christmas, it looks as though many skiers will need to head to higher ground and manufactured slopes if they are to get some skiing action in this festive season.
The Silveretta Ski Resort in Montafon is one of the few ski resorts open in the Vorarlberg region, but the über luxurious ski resort of Lech and Zürs am Arlberg and the hugely popular Sankt Anton are still waiting for a heavy dusting of snow so that they can open their ski lifts.
Those lucky enough to be staying in Lech over the Christmas and New Year period will be able to practice their snowplough on one of the many ‘artificial’ slopes created using 96 snow cannons, and with limited snow available, you could well be sharing the slopes with Royalty, Pop Stars and A-list celebs – so it’s not all bad!
Austria’s famous ski resorts of Ischgl, Sölden and Kitzbühl are doing better on the snow front, and so if you are heading to one of these amazing ski resorts for your Christmas break, you can expect plenty of snow, plenty of sunshine, and all the après ski you could possibly wish for!
